Product Overview
The Rosemount 3051CG2A02A1AB4K5Y2L5M5HR7+0305RC22A11 represents a pinnacle of precision pressure measurement, integrating a high-performance integral manifold with a PTFE (Teflon) wetted diaphragm. Designed for demanding process environments, this transmitter delivers a 4-20 mA output signal overlaid with digital HART® Protocol communication, enabling remote configuration and diagnostics. The unit is engineered to measure differential pressure across a range of -250 to +250 inH₂O (-621.60 to +621.60 mbar) for the 3051CD/CG variant, or gauge pressure up to 150 psia (0 to 10.34 bar) for the 3051CA variant. The integral manifold assembly (model suffix 0305RC22A11) streamlines installation by combining the transmitter and valve system into a single, leak-tight unit, reducing potential leak paths and overall footprint in critical process lines.
Key Features & High-End Benefits
The Rosemount 3051CG2A02A1AB4K5Y2L5M5HR7+0305RC22A11 delivers operational integrity through its robust construction and advanced electronics. The PTFE (Teflon) material selection for the diaphragm ensures superior chemical resistance and non-stick properties, making it ideal for corrosive, viscous, or polymerizing media where standard stainless steel would degrade. The HART® Protocol digital communication allows for real-time process optimization, enabling operators to perform remote zeroing, range adjustments, and multi-variable diagnostics without physical access to the transmitter. The integral manifold eliminates the need for separate valve assemblies, reducing installation costs and maintaining system integrity under high-cycle or thermal stress conditions.
